Overview
Birthday Bounty is a playable web experience, not a page. You identify yourself at a space terminal, accept a bounty, and move through the ship — arcade, radio, encrypted database — until a transmission depending on your birth date.
The problem
A gift needed to be something you inhabit. A static greeting would not hold a point of view; the piece had to be a small game with progress and an ending that belongs to the person playing.
The approach
Structure the piece as rooms and missions. CRT, pixel type and a snarky console carry a space-western tone. Progress and audio live in the browser. On mobile, a bottom bar moves between ship locations instead of desktop hover chrome.
The solution
Access gate, boot sequence, bounty network, cockpit hub, arcade mini-games, radio stations, a subject database, a secret signal, and a finale that splits between celebration, memories, or a locked channel — depending on the date you entered.
